About NEC Merit Scholarship 2024 for NER

The North Eastern Council (NEC) under the Ministry of Development of the North Eastern Region, Government of India has created a new scholarship scheme that is especially available for the students currently situated in the Northeastern cities of the country. Through the NEC Merit Scholarship, you will be able to apply for various scholarship programs and will be able to get Rupees 30000 per year in order to continue your education. NEC Merit Scholarship Eligibility Criteria

The applicant must follow the following eligibility criteria to apply for the scholarship:-

  • The scholarship is open only to a student who is a permanent resident of any of the North Eastern States.
  • For candidates belonging to Academic Year 2020-21 and onwards, the scholarship under this scheme shall be disbursed only through National Scholarship Portal (NSP). However, the students, who already have been receiving scholarships before these rules came into force, shall continue to receive their scholarships as per the prevailing procedure till the end of the tenure of their scholarship.
  • Once selected, the scholarship shall be available to a selected student for the prescribed duration of a course subject to fulfillment of renewal conditions, as specified under Para 6 of these rules. Extension of scholarship beyond the prescribed period of study will not be entertained.
  • At the time of availing of the scholarship, the student must not be in receipt of any other scholarship/financial assistance from any other source. A sponsored candidate under full employment during the period of study or working/in-service candidates shall not be eligible to receive the scholarship.
  • A student shall only be considered for a scholarship in the year of commencement of his/her course. For the subsequent year, of course, only renewal will be allowed.
  • The scholarship shall be admissible to students who get admission in Diploma, Degree, Post-graduate or registration in M.Phil. /Ph.D. courses of any institute recognized by the Government. The grant of scholarship for M.Phil and Ph.D. would be after the registration of the students with the University. The Scholarship will not be available for an internship or any practical training.
  • The scholarship shall be admissible to the students whose parent/guardian’s annual income from all sources shall not exceed Rs 8.0 lakh. The income certificate issued by the competent authority shall be furnished by the candidate.

Educational Qualification

The student must fulfill the following eligibility criteria in the previous qualifying examination for consideration for a scholarship:

  • Diploma
    • Qualifying examination: HSLC/HSSLC/Secondary School Leaving /Senior Secondary Leaving Certificate examination from a recognized State/Central Board with a minimum of 60% marks in aggregate.
  • Degree
    • Qualifying examination: HSSLC/Senior Secondary Leaving Certificate examination from a recognized State/Central Board with a minimum of 60% marks in aggregate.
  • Post Graduate
    • Qualifying examination: Degree level examination in any discipline (BA/BSc/BE/B Tech/MBBS/LLB/BCA/BBA etc. of any recognized Institute/ University with minimum 60% marks in aggregate.
  • M.Phil./Ph.D
    • Qualifying examination: PG degree from any recognized University with a minimum of 60% marks in aggregate.

Selection Process of NEC Merit Scholarship

The applicant will have to go through the following selection criteria to apply for the scholarship:-

  • The merit lists will be drawn from among finally verified applications as per the scheme guidelines and after following the laid down procedure on the NSP.
  • Selection of students for M. Phil and Ph. D. will be done on the basis of the topic of research/Synopsis which has relevance to the problems/issues related to the NE Region. The Subjects/topics for M.Phil and Ph.D. should invariably be directly, specifically, and currently relevant to NE Region. Basic and theoretical research shall not be favored in general.
  • The scholarship is purely on a merit basis. The merit list will be prepared exclusively on the basis of marks obtained by the candidate in the qualifying exams and complying with the level-of-course-wise slots allotted to the states.

NEC Merit Scholarship Amount

The scholarship amount in this scheme is as follows:-

  • Diploma: 20,000/-p.a.
  • Degree: 22,000/- p.a.
  • Postgraduate: 25,000/- p.a.
  • M. Phil./Ph D: 30,000/- p.a.

Number Of Scholarship

The following numbers of scholarships are available in this scheme:-

  • Arunachal Pradesh: 209 [Diploma: 20, Degree: 130, PG Degree: 52, M.Phil / Ph.D.: 7 ]
  • Assam: 320 [Diploma: 30, Degree: 200, PG Degree: 80, M.Phil / Ph.D.: 10 ]
  • Manipur: 192 [Diploma: 18, Degree: 120, PG Degree: 48, M.Phil / Ph.D.: 6 ]
  • Meghalaya: 192 [Diploma: 18, Degree: 120, PG Degree: 48, M.Phil / Ph.D.: 6 ]
  • Mizoram: 192 [Diploma: 18, Degree: 120, PG Degree: 48, M.Phil / Ph.D.: 6 ]
  • Nagaland: 192 [Diploma: 18, Degree: 120, PG Degree: 48, M.Phil / Ph.D.: 6 ]
  • Sikkim: 111 [Diploma: 10, Degree: 70, PG Degree: 28, M.Phil / Ph.D.: 3]
  • Tripura: 192 [Diploma: 18, Degree: 120, PG Degree: 48, M.Phil / Ph.D.: 6 ]
Documents Required

The applicant must have the following documents to apply for the scholarship:-

  • Permanent Residential Certificate (PRC) issued by the Dy. Commissioner /Addl. Dy. Commissioners/ Sub-divisional officers of civil sub-divisions in the NE States; except Sikkim where a Certificate of Identification (COI) is issued by the respective Deputy Commissioner in the Govt. of Sikkim to its Permanent residents. A certificate from any other authority will not be accepted. (Mandatory)
  • Income Certificate issued by the Competent Authority (Mandatory)
  • Bank Account Pass Book – The account must be in the name of the applicant (Optional)
  • Details of qualifying examination (Mandatory)
  • Synopsis signed by the project guide / Director (Research) or any official authorized by the Institute/University in the case of M.Phil/Ph.D. candidates (Mandatory).

NEC Merit Scholarship Renewal

The conditions for scholarship renewal are as follows:-

  • A student selected for a scholarship shall be eligible for receipt of the scholarship for the entire period of the course or as per limits through the renewal of the scholarship process. Renewal of Scholarship under the scheme, however, is not an automatic process and is subject to fulfillment of certain terms and conditions
  • Every renewal of the scholarship is for a period of one academic year only, if not otherwise specified. All existing and eligible beneficiaries of the scholarship are required to fill up the renewal form on NSP every year during their entire course period. The student shall be required to upload the previous exam marks sheet/pass certificate during the renewal application. In the case of students studying an M.Phil / PhD., the renewal application shall be accompanied by the latest progress report from the guide countersigned by the Registrar of the Institute.
  • To draw a scholarship under the renewal category, the beneficiary must pass in the particular year or be promoted to the next semester/year. In case the student could not pass all papers but was promoted to next year, as per extant rules, he/she may be considered for renewal of scholarships subject to the condition that no additional backlog, from previous years, is pending against his/her name. In case the student is not promoted to next year or has backlog papers pending against his/her name for more than one year, he/she shall not receive further scholarship for the remaining course period. It will be the responsibility of the Institute level verifying officer to ensure that the student has been promoted to a year or does not have pending backlog papers for more than a year, before accepting the application on NSP for further processing. Otherwise, such applications shall be rejected on NSP after recording reasons.
  • Any break in scholarship, during the entire course period, shall make the beneficiary non-eligible for further receipt of the scholarship for that specific course. The students shall not be provided with an option to make renewal applications in subsequent years. The student may, however, apply as a fresh applicant, upon securing admission to any advanced course, at a later stage.
  • A request for renewal of students who have changed their subject of study will not be entertained for renewal if the students have availed of the scholarship for the previous course or part of it.
  • A request for renewal of scholarship of such student beneficiaries who have changed their Institution of study will not be entertained for renewal.
  • There will be no merit list generation for renewal applications.
  • Renewal scholarship will be disbursed to all eligible and duly verified applications by NEC, directly in their verified bank accounts using DBT mode as per the extant guidelines
